Amazon.co.uk Review
Therersquo;s a lot thatrsquo;s fitted in to IHeroes/Irsquo; third season, a run that tried valiantly to correct some of the problems that the show encountered with its less-than-successful second series. Season three features two volumes of the IHeroes/I story, Villains and Fugitives, but once more it gets off to a bumpy start. p The early stages of IHeroes/Irsquo; third season suffer from many of the problems that plagued season two, as it tries to deal with the threads that were left behind. But the show finally finds its feet as it heads towards the back end of the series, with a genuine feeling returning that the show knows exactly which way itrsquo;s going again. Characters begin to find out more about one another, therersquo;s a bit more of a grounding in some kind of reality, and finally a narrative thrust that scoops back up many who have been left baffled by the direction that IHeroes/I has taken since its terrific maiden season. p And itrsquo;s good to see the show back on form. Even in its weaker moments, IHeroes/Irsquo; production values were sky high, and there are many genuinely impressive sequences thrown in your direction over the course of season three. But most impressive of all is the feeling that the show has dug itself out of the hole that it managed to find itself in, and courtesy of an impressive rally at its back end, season three is certainly worth picking up. Even if you might need to grit your teeth a bit in the early stages… --IJon Foster/I

Everyone remembers Season One - it was good because it was dark and mysterious and very real-world. I think that's why Season Two didn't hold up - it had that clean, bright, "PG-13" feel to it. I mean, in Season One, the main characters were an internet stripper and a heroin addicit! br / br /Season Three goes back to that good old, more mature feel - and it works. br /The season is split into two volumes - "Villains" is the story of 12 murderous Company captives breaking out, with someone believed dead trying to artificially create powers; br /and "Fugitives" - The heroes have been betrayed to the government and are forced underground as fugitives, being hunted by Homeland Security. br / br /The story moves along at a much faster pace - a vast improvement over Season Two which took 7 episodes to start the plot rolling! Lots of new cast members are very fun to watch: Zeljko Ivanek is affably evil as hero-hunter "Emile Danko"; Robert Foster as the back-from-the-dead-dad "Arthur Petrelli"; Daphne Millbrook, Flint, Jesse, Knox and Usutu are all great new characters - even some much-loved old faced return, like Linderman and Meredith Gordon (Claire's bio-mum). br / br /Heroes Season Three is definetly worth buying.
